What is Costco’s marketing strategy?

Costco Wholesale uses the market-oriented pricing strategy. This pricing strategy uses market conditions as basis for setting prices. In general, the company aims to offer the lowest possible prices for bulk/wholesale purchases, relative to the prices of other firms in the retail market.

What is Costco’s marketing mix?

Costco offers products which are widely available. Hence pricing is a strategy in its marketing mix which is critically dependent upon the competition, amount of goods sold etc. Costco is known for having specially low prices for bulk purchases, and also special prices on limited edition goods.

Who is Costco’s target market?

Costco’s target market is middle to upper-income and educated customers such as those working in management, medicine, finance, law, IT, and government as of 2021. Costco’s market is not generally gender or ethnicity-specific, but it does target people who are aged 30 and above and have their own families.

What is unique about Costco’s strategy that attracts customer?

Costco’s strategy has always been to target affluent consumers who want to save money but also want to shop in a customer-friendly environment. By targeting affluent customers, the company is able to generate strong revenue while dealing in a much-limited product range as compared to Walmart.

Does Costco have a marketing budget?

Costco spends essentially zero. It has no advertising budget, though it does spring for mailers targeted to prospective members and coupons sent to existing members.

How does Costco segment their market?

Segmentation of demographics for Costco is vast as the current product offerings include all genders, ethnicities, incomes. age groups, and social classes. When considering demographics, it is important to consider the average or typical characteristics of the target market.

What is Costco’s competitive advantage?

Costco’s key competitive advantages are economy of scale, less reliance on making a profit from the sales of goods and more emphasis on profits derived from membership fees and from ancillary department sales and services such as the food court and hearing aid centers.

What makes Costco so successful?

The success of Costco Wholesale , which has been evident during the pandemic, is based on a membership model, low prices, quality goods, limited selection, a treasure-hunt environment, and motivated employees.
